cDot11AssStatsAssociated

Module: CISCO-DOT11-ASSOCIATION-MIB

OID (symbolic): CISCO-DOT11-ASSOCIATION-MIB::cDot11AssStatsAssociated

OID (numeric): 1.3.6.1.4.1.9.9.273.1.1.3.1.1

Node type: OBJECT-TYPE

Type: Counter32

Access: read-only

Description: This object counts the number of stations associated with this device on this interface since device re-started.

What is cDot11AssStatsAssociated?

A cumulative counter of wireless stations that have associated with this device on this interface since the device last restarted.

Examples

Walk all instances (SNMPv2c):

snmpwalk -v2c -c public <target> 1.3.6.1.4.1.9.9.273.1.1.3.1.1
snmpwalk -v2c -c public <target> CISCO-DOT11-ASSOCIATION-MIB::cDot11AssStatsAssociated

Get a specific instance (index 1):

snmpget -v2c -c public <target> 1.3.6.1.4.1.9.9.273.1.1.3.1.1.1
snmpget -v2c -c public <target> CISCO-DOT11-ASSOCIATION-MIB::cDot11AssStatsAssociated.1
